Take me where the mountains sing to my soul
Where the birds’ song makes me whole
Take me where the air is pure and whispers through trees
Where nature guides with tender care and we walk as it sees
Let me run free in the canyons between mountain peaks
Where the waterfalls rush and softly speak
Show me the world as the Gods intended it
Before we decided their reign had ended
Remind me of a time when Mother Earth deeply loved
Before trees were fewer than the stars above
